Like most eyewear brands, measurements for Warby Parker glasses can be found on the inside of the temple arm. There you’ll find lens width (50 mm), bridge (17 mm), and temple length (140 mm). If you already have a pair that you like, you can compare it to those measurements.

  • Frame width 131 mm: The horizontal diameter of the full frame width, and it’s the primary way we determine fit. (Note: You will not find this number on your glasses.)
  • Lens width 50 mm: The horizontal diameter of one lens.
  • Bridge 17 mm: The width of the bridge section.
  • Temple length 140 mm: The length of the entire temple arm, from the front of the frame to the tip.
  • Made from hand-polished cellulose acetate
  • Akulon-coated screws for durability

Becton Quality

The frame uses Custom-designed cellulose acetate, which is a renewable, plant-based material. It helps Becton keep its shape, brilliance, prolific hues, and patterns over time. Acetate frames are not only environmentally friendly but also durable, flexible, and hypoallergenic. Akulon-coated screws with barrel hinges provide durability to the frames. Wheel polishing helps the eyewear to achieve its glossy finish. Made entirely from acetate, Becton is lightweight and comfortable to wear all day long.

Warby Parker Timeline

“Making a difference, one pair of eyeglasses at a time” is what defines Warby Parker. It is a socially conscious company which is one of the leading eyewear companies in the United States, founded in 2010. It was born out of a problem that conceptualized into a world-changing idea. The concept of Warby Parker came to four college students when one of them lost their eyeglasses during a backpacking trip. In the quest to replace them, the prices quoted by local optical stores were astronomical. They decided to find an alternative to this problem of sky-shooting prices of a basic necessity. Warby Parker’s “Buy One Pair, Give One Pair” program donates a pair of eyeglasses for every pair sold. This notion not only encourages individuals to have access to reasonably priced eyewear but also builds compassion in the community.
